Lightning Fleet Summer Series

The Lightning Fleet 329 had a great turn out for the 2-Day SSA Lighting Summer Series 08/26/23-08/27/23.  Race committee did an excellent job of running the five races in White Hall Bay with shifty conditions from the N-NW.  There were six boats racing and three first time regatta participants…

This was an extra-special event for Lightning 14120, "Rosencrantz & Guildenstern”.  This was the first time, under new ownership, 14120 was on the start line, and had she two first-time regatta crew!  Ben Jarashow had Bennett Lacy as middle crew; Bennet is a an aspiring Eagle Scout hoping to earn his sailing badge (and we are hoping a love of Lighting racing) and first time in a sailboat!  In addition, Ben had his daughter Hannah Jarashow making her debut in forward and skipper in her first regatta!  When asked how she liked racing Hannah replied: “I didn’t get to drive, but I got to hold the tiller and keep the boat straight during the races!”

Our Fleet Captain Jonathan Lange, who often brings on new people to race with him, also had a first time regatta participant.  This was Henry Carlson's first regatta and he really enjoyed sailing with Jonathan & Michael.

It was great to see a strong showing our fleet and want to thank everyone who raced.  Congratulations to team Hurban, who despite several close finishes, continued to keep their strong lead and finished in first place!
